Transaction 8e35f17601fc055de0f36aee5114b7873452500272bd7c673f16550d95cae02e
1 Input
1 Output
-
8e35f17601fc055de0f36aee5114b7873452500272bd7c673f16550d95cae02e:0
- value
- 173896800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b15aebe745a8ff77fd69a2ce28a7cd99ce3ae237 OP_EQUAL
- address
- 3HrnSqLKppRgUambv7BRZwfKxnSAMApk1M